Kipferon suppositories are an immunomodulatory drug for rectal and vaginal use. When the doctor prescribes this drug to the baby, the mothers are often embarrassed, because the kipferon suppositories for children are not intended. But in reality in pediatric practice they are used quite often.

The composition of suppositories of kipferon, in addition to the traditional auxiliary components included in the suppository, includes human immunoglobulin and interferon alfa-2. The first active substance is an antibody, which is an important component of immunity. Thanks to them, the body can identify and destroy alien bodies. Interferon is a protein group secreted by cells as a response of the body to the penetration of pathological organisms into it. The effect of interferon is that it does not allow the viruses to multiply in the body and spread in it.

The use of kipferon

Indications for the use of kipferon are a variety of infections. This drug improves the body's immune response. Quite often, kipferon is an excellent remedy for ARVI, which proceeds quite hard. Its effectiveness in influenza, pneumonia and bronchitis has also been proven. In addition, these suppositories can be prescribed for a number of other infections: chlamydia, kili infection, hepatitis, herpes, as well as intestinal infections of viral and bacterial origin. Since kipferon is available in the form of candles, it can be used even in the treatment of newborns that have been infected by the mother during labor. The suppository is administered after an enema or an act of bowel movement in the rectum of the child. Babies usually tolerate this procedure well.

Concerning side effects of kipferon, in some cases there is an allergic reaction in the form of a small rash or red spots. Then the replacement of the drug is required. Like other medicines, candles of kipferon have contraindications. These include an individual reaction to the components of suppositories.
